Choose portrait or landscape to suit your wall
Both portrait and landscape formats are equally popular for Goldfinches artworks, giving you flexibility for different spaces. Portrait works well above narrow console tables or in hallways, while landscape suits wider walls above sofas or beds. Choose the format that fits your available wall space.

Pair warm neutrals with natural accents
The beige and taupe tones popular in this collection work beautifully with wood furniture and natural textures like linen or rattan. These soft, earthy hues create a calming backdrop that won't compete with your existing décor. The muted palette in The goldfinch, Carel Fabritius pairs especially well with oak or walnut frames.
